CHT 3515

Bodies, Bodies, Bodies in Premodern China

Catalog description

Surveys a selection of classical approaches to the study of the body before analyzing and comparing several common literary, philosophical, medical (TCM), mantic, religious, and political representations of the human body in different eras of premodern Chinese culture. Tensions between traditionalism and modernity are examined in the final weeks of the course. All readings and discussion are in English.
